Charyl Stockwell Preparatory Academy and Roeper are an even 5-5 against one another since January of 2019, but not for long. The Sentinels will be home for the holidays to greet the Roughriders at 7:00 p.m. on Friday. Charyl Stockwell Preparatory Academy is looking for their season's first win.
On Tuesday, Charyl Stockwell Preparatory Academy had to suffer through a 70-33 loss at the hands of Whitmore Lake. That's two games in a row now that the Sentinels have lost by exactly 37 points.
Meanwhile, Roeper hadn't done well against Our Lady of the Lakes recently (they were 0-3 in their previous three matchups), but they didn't let the past get in their way on Tuesday. The Roughriders walked away with a 49-42 victory over the Lakers. The win made it back-to-back victories for the Roughriders.
Roeper now has a winning record of 3-2. As for Charyl Stockwell Preparatory Academy, their defeat dropped their record down to 0-5.
Charyl Stockwell Preparatory Academy lost to Roeper at home by a decisive 52-38 margin in their previous matchup back in February of 2024. Can the Sentinels avenge their loss or is history doomed to repeat itself? We'll find out soon enough.
